157 DD/P/8/128 1 Feb. 1633/4

These documents are held at Nottinghamshire Archives

Contents:

Lease for 1,000 years at peppercorn rent: Henry Ogle of Welbeck gent. to William, Earl of Newcastle:-- all property of H.O. in cos. Derby, Notts., and York "or elsewhere in England" --: Witn. Robert Butler, Thomas Bullidge, Tho. Gibson. Seal. Endorsed "Cottam".

DD/4P/42/31 will: 3 Aug. 1632; prob: 5 Aug. 1636

These documents are held at Nottinghamshire Archives

Contents:

Probate will of Hen. Ogle of Welbeck.

To be buried at Bolsover.

To Lady Jane Cavendishe, £100.

To Lord Mansfield, Wm. Cavendishe, Hen. Cavendish, and Eliz. Cavendish, £10 each.

To nephew Hen. Ogle, all clothes except 1 red velvet suit for Jane C.'s disposal, a green velvet suit laid with silver late for my Lady Newcastle's service and 1 cloth suit for servant Raphe Wolley. To R.W., £5 and an arming (?) sword.

To Sir Chas. Cavendishe, horse called Blacke Richardson.

Earl of Newcastle, executor, to dispose of residue as thinks fit, paying 20s. to Anne Wolley and £5 to poor of Bolsover.

Deanery of Retford probate; seal missing. Parch.
